Pathsala: With the upgradation work of the Bajali College of Pathsala to Bhattadev University, Dr. Birinchi Kumar Das was officially appointed as the Vice Chancellor of the new University in the state of Assam on Tuesday.

Earlier, on June 16, 2019, in view of upgrading Bajali College of Pathsala to Bhattadev University, a citizens’ meet urged the authority to continue 10+2 level in the new university.

The meeting held in the digital hall of the college on Saturday discussed various issues related to education in the university.

The meeting thanked the government for appointing a new Vice-Chancellor in Bhattadev University. The meeting further demanded to redress the various problems in the internal administration of the college and to improve the internal environment of the college. The meeting urged the State Education Minister and Vice-Chancellor to maintain its name and fame. The meeting decided to submit a memorandum to Chancellor Prof Jagadish Mukhi and the State Education Minister to continue the 10+2 stage in the university. A committee was formed to prepare the memorandum.

It is to be noted that Bajali College was established on August 16, 1955.

The initial mission of the College was to spread the ray of higher education in preservation and creation of knowledge and to inculcate scientific temperament among the rural populace besides providing accessibility of higher education to women of the area.

But very soon, it became one of the leading co-educational institutions imparting education right from HS to PG level. Now it aspires to take the leading part in the over-all development of higher education in the form of teaching, training, consultancy, research and extension services to the stakeholders.

To meet with the challenges of globalization of education, the college strives to re-orient and reshape its programmes to make the present system more relevant and career oriented with a focus on quality and excellence.
